
Six welcomes Comunus Sicav as a new publisher in six Swiss exchanges.
The Fund, the Comunus Sicav – Swiss, available in CHF (ISIN CH0200600911), increases the total number of mutual funds negotiating on the Swiss stock market to 48, of which 46 are classified as real estate funds.
According to Comunus, his fund’s list is a natural development of the development strategy planned since the start of mutual capital in 2013 and deals with two strategic goals: to provide increased liquidity to today’s investors of mutual capital and to expand the base of investors. Its investment strategy focuses on acquiring older buildings with significant opportunities for transformation and renovation in the French speech of Switzerland, especially in the area of Lake Geneva.
Making the public accessible to the public, Comunus expects to gain access to funds required to take advantage of the acquisitions of the Swiss real estate market.

Comunus is the first new real estate fund publisher to participate in the Six Swiss Exchange in 2025.
Comunus is a Swiss real estate investment fund allowed by the Swiss financial market supervision (FINMA). As a self -managed SICAV investment company, it has its own experience management and management of capital. Founded in 2013 by deep-rooted real estate professionals in the area of Lake Geneva, Comunus is focusing on its activities on French-Miley of Switzerland. It offers both institutional and private investors a collective investment vehicle in the housing sector.
